There’s no escaping the pull of desire in this novel in #1 New York Times bestselling author Christine Feehan’s Torpedo Ink motorcycle club series.

When Czar shut down Lazar “Keys” Alexeev’s undercover mission, that should have been the end of the story. Instead, Keys is back in the middle of a nowhere town where a petite redhead with a pouty mouth and a ready smile drives him to distraction. He’s not sure why he’s breaking all of Torpedo Ink’s rules to spend more time around a woman who’s not even his type. He can’t get her out of his head—and now he’s facing the consequences.

Lyric Johansen doesn’t like to look anyone in the eyes, but Keys’s gaze is the one thing keeping her from a full-on panic attack. Her instinct to charge into the fray and help the biker fend off a group of vicious thugs has led to the most insane situation she’s ever been in: trapped in a coffin with a man she barely knows, minutes away from a painful death.

Survival means staying focused. But when Keys kisses Lyric to snap her out of losing it, he’s the one who ends up falling apart. He’ll need to unleash hell to get them out alive.

If only to get another taste. …

Twisted Road continues the stories of the men of Torpedo Ink. This series is one I drop everything for! So, when Twisted Road hit my kindle, I gobbled it up!

This book starts full on in the action! It took me a minute (and a check back to my previous reviews) to refresh my memories about all the characters. I actually liked Lyric and Keys more than I expected! Keys has always been one of the guys I was less interested in learning about. However, he and Lyric are really good for each other. It was a well balanced relationship in that respect! Keys was still problematic at times, but it was certainly a story where I realize what’s good for thee might be bad for me! The relationship worked for Keys and Lyric. Lyric was really what made the book for me though. She is delightful! She has her own personal struggles, but she is aware of her issues and is upfront with them. She is strong in unconventional ways, which I loved.

These two are pushed together during intense circumstances. Survival will require all the skills they both possess! Twisted Road delivers danger and heat!

About Christine Feehan

Christine Feehan is a #1 New York Times bestselling author multiple times over with her portfolio including over 40 published novels, including five series; Leopard Series, Dark Series, Ghostwalker Series, Drake Sisters Series, & the Sisters of the Heart Series. All five series hit the #1 spot on the New York Times bestselling list as well. Her debut novel Dark Prince received 3 of the 9 Paranormal Excellence Awards in Romantic Literature (PEARL) in 1999. Since then she has been published by various publishing houses including Leisure BooksPocket Books, and currently is writing for Berkley/Jove. She also has earned 7 more PEARL awards since Dark Prince.

In addition to the #1 New York Times bestsellers list and the PEARL awards, Christine is honored to have made the bestsellers list for Amazon, B. Daltons, Barnes and Nobles, Bookscan, Borders, Ingrams, Publishers Weekly, Rhapsody Book Club, USA Today, Waldenbooks, Walmart, and the Washington Post. Other honors that she has received include being a nominee for the Romance Writers of America’s RITA award, receiving the Career Achievement Award for Contemporary New Reality from Romantic Times Magazine in 2003 and in 2008 the Borders Lifetime Achievement Award.

She has been published in multiple languages and in many formats, including audio book, e-book, hardcover and large print.  In October of 2007 her first manga comic, Dark Hunger was released in stores.  This was the first ever manga comic released by Berkley Publishing and it made #11 on Publisher’s Weekly Bestseller’s List. Her ground-breaking book trailer commercials have been shown on TV and in the movie theaters. She has been featured on local TV, appeared on the The Montel Williams Show, and her book Dark Legend was featured on the cover of Romantic Times Magazine.

Christine Feehan has also appeared at numerous writers’ conventions and book signings including: Romantic Times ConventionGet Caught Reading at Sea CruiseCelebrate Romance ConferenceEmerald City Conference, and numerous Romance Writers of America Conferences. She was also a special guest at the 2013 Comic Con and now has her own FAN convention.
